# Break-Glass: Canary Gating Overrides

Rollouts on the Pinewhistle platform halt automatically when canary error rates breach gating thresholds. Support staff normally cannot override gates. During a confirmed false-positive block with the release team unavailable, break-glass override is allowed. File an incident record first, then unlock the override console. The console prompts for the emergency passphrase, shown below.

unlock words, yawig-kagef: gordor-holvan-ulaael-pramir-ulaiel-tamdor

Subject: Handover — Lexicrane autocomplete index

Hi Tomas, welcome aboard.

The Lexicrane autocomplete index has been slow since Tuesday's shard rebalance. I've documented the symptoms in the runbook: p95 latency above 400ms, mostly on prefix queries under three characters. Do not restart the indexer mid-compaction — it corrupts the suffix trie. Check the rebalance logs first, then the memory graphs. If anything looks unfamiliar, the search platform team answers quickly at their group address.

escalation mailbox, bafog-fafog: ulador@paliqlabs.internal

## Authentication

The Scanlark barcode scanner integration authenticates against our internal Veldrome Lookup Service, which resolves scanned SKUs to warehouse bins. Before running the integration locally, confirm you are on the Tarnwick office VPN, as the service rejects external traffic outright. All requests must include the key in the X-Veldrome-Key header; omitting it returns a 401 with no body, which can be confusing during first setup. Rotate keys only through the Veldrome console, never by hand. Use the key below.

gateway credential: kto3_qfe

The credentials vault for SnackRoute, the vending-machine restock planner, locked itself after three failed deploy attempts last night. Release 2.9 cannot ship until the vault reopens — the route-optimizer service can't pull its signing material.

Dorvin from platform confirmed the auto-lock wasn't triggered by intrusion, just a clock skew on the Halverton build node. Safe to unlock manually.

Steps: open the vault console, select manual recovery, confirm the audit prompt. When asked, enter the recovery passphrase below:

unlock words, yadup-bafog: belwyn-gorwyn-norok-novwyn-goriel-ulaox-framir-queneth-oliion